How Old is Your Water Heater? – The lifespan of a traditional tank water heater is about a decade. Past that, and repairs will become more frequent. Modern tankless water heaters have a higher up front cost, but double the lifespan.
What Are Those Noises? – No, your water heater should not be making odd noises. If you’re hearing sounds coming from your system, call a professional plumber to address the issue.
Why is the Water that Color? – Rusty water and discoloration are evidence of a rusting water heater. Professional repair is necessary to return your water to healthy, useable condition.
Is My Water Heater Leaking? – Water accumulation around the tank is evidence of a leak. This can cause a lot of water damage, and as soon as pooling water is identified, the situation should be addressed by a licensed technician.

Even a small leak in your water heater can cause major damage. Action must be taken quickly. In many cases, leaks can be repaired without having to replace your water heater. The first objective is to find out where the leak is coming from. Cleaning up the spill is important to prevent damage and mold, but the problem will not go away unless it is addressed at the source. If the water heater is leaking, turn off the water, turn off the power or gas source, and check the appliance. Common sources of leaks are the hose inlet/outlet, the pressure relief valve, the drain valve, or a crack in the bottom of the tank. Excessive inlet water pressure can also cause problems. Maintenance can improve water heater performance, efficiency, and longevity. One of the most important routine tasks is to flush a water heater of sediment and scale that can build up in the tank and water lines. These can eventually clog the device and cause serious damage. Other important forms of water heater maintenance include adjusting the water temperature, testing the temperature relief valve, and insulating the pipe to prevent condensation. Water tank insulation can improve efficiency and performance.
